H&M returns to London Fashion Week with A/W 25 Collections



Swedish fashion giant H&M makes a bold return to London Fashion Week to celebrate the A/W 25 season.

Titled 'The London Issue', the event consisted of a daytime programme of fashion talks and workshops featuring figures shaping the landscape of contemporary fashion such as legendary editor Katie Grand, and acclaimed stylist Jacob K. This was followed by a hybrid fashion show spotlighting the H&M design vision featuring models Alex Consani, Paloma Elsesser, Amelia Gray, Angelina Kendall and Sora Choi who also appear in a campaign shot in London by Anthony Seklaoui and Mitch Ryan and styled by Jacob K.

'H&M believes in providing a stage for creativity in all its guises. We are thrilled to be collaborating with so many industry leaders and incredible creative forces who are defining self-expression and ground-breaking style,' Ann-Sofie Johansson, Head of Design & Creative Advisor H&M stated in a press release.

A celebration of culture, style, sound, art, and London's rule-breaking spirit, H&M's A/W25 collection consists of two drops with the first chapter looking to the cultural revolution of late 90s Britain, Britpop, 90s high fashion icons and leaders.
